i
1 Ascent HR Technologies Private Limited Job
4-8 years
Java Full Stack Developer - Spring Boot/AngularJS (4-8 yrs)
Ascent HR Technologies Private Limited
posted 1mon ago
Flexible timing
Key skills for the job
Key Responsibilities :
- Design, develop, and maintain robust and scalable web applications using Java, J2EE, Spring, Hibernate, and related technologies.
- Develop and consume RESTful APIs for seamless integration with other systems.
- Implement and maintain front-end applications using Angular, React, or similar JavaScript frameworks.
- Participate in all phases of the software development lifecycle, including requirements gathering, design, development, testing, and deployment.
- Write clean, well-documented, and maintainable code adhering to best practices and coding standards.
- Conduct thorough unit and integration testing to ensure code quality and reliability.
- Collaborate effectively with cross-functional teams, including product managers, designers, and QA engineers.
- Troubleshoot and resolve technical issues in a timely and efficient manner.
- Stay abreast of the latest technologies and industry trends in web development.
- Contribute to a positive and collaborative team environment.
Required Skills and Experience :
- 4-8 years of professional experience in Java development.
- Strong proficiency in Java, J2EE, Spring Boot, Spring MVC, Spring Data, Spring Batch, and Spring Schedulers.
- Experience with ORM frameworks like Hibernate and JPA.
- Hands-on experience with REST API development and consumption.
- Strong understanding of database concepts and experience with Oracle databases.
- Proficiency in front-end technologies such as Angular, React, JavaScript, TypeScript, HTML, and CSS.
- Experience with build tools like Maven and Gradle.
- Experience with version control systems like Git and Bitbucket.
- Experience with unit testing frameworks like JUnit and Mockito.
- Experience with Agile/Scrum methodologies.
- Excellent communication and interpersonal skills.
- Strong problem-solving and analytical skills.
- A passion for learning and a desire to stay updated on the latest technologies.
Nice-to-Have Skills :
- Experience with cloud platforms such as AWS or Azure.
- Experience with microservices architecture.
- Experience with containerization technologies like Docker and Kubernetes.
- Experience with log management tools like ELK stack (Elasticsearch, Logstash, Kibana).
- Experience with security tools like Fortify, Veracode, or Checkmarx
Functional Areas: Other
Read full job descriptionPrepare for Java Full Stack Developer roles with real interview advice